Handover note — Crumbwheel order cutoffs.

Welcome aboard. The bakery cutoff rule in Crumbwheel closes same-day orders at 14:00 local to each storefront, not UTC — this has bitten us twice. Holiday overrides live in the calendar service and take precedence silently, so always check there first when a cutoff looks wrong. To unlock the calendar service's admin console after a restart, enter the recovery passphrase below.

vault phrase of bagap-bahaf = silion-pelox-sorox-casdor-quenwyn-fraax-eliox-praael-kelion-quenvan-kasox-rusael-norius-belvan

Capacity note for Trailmark's offline mode — hi, new contractor! Surveyors in the Kerrow Valley pilot sync maybe once a day, so local queues balloon fast. We cap cached photos and pending edits per device; past that, the app nags them to sync. Don't guess at the ceilings, they came from real field data. Here are the numbers we settled on.

tuning constants:
QUOTAS = {
    "druwyn": 5,
    "holix": 5,
    "zorath": 5,
    "holwyn": 10,
}

Quarterly Planning Note — Divestiture of the Coastal Tooling Unit

For the finance team: the sale of the Coastal Tooling unit to Pellmark Industries remains on track for close in Q3. Please finalize the carve-out balance sheet, reconcile intercompany positions, and prepare the working-capital adjustment schedule by month-end. Audit support requests should be prioritized. For planning purposes, note the following sensitive item:

internal memo for hawef-kahif: The finance team signed off on a budget of $25.9 million for Project Sorox. The renewal with Pelokek Logistics closes at $51.7 million a year, 52 percent below the last contract.

- [ ] **Quiet room orientation (top floor).** On the new starter's first morning, walk them up to the Fernside quiet room on Level 6, pointing out the booking tablet by the door and the no-calls rule posted inside. Show them how to adjust the blinds and where the spare chargers are kept in the side cabinet. Make sure they understand the room must be left clear of belongings. The keypad entry code for the quiet room is given below.

staff pass of kawip-hawef = bdg-QLP-2